Headset
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of acoustics, and particularly relates to a headphone.
Background
Headphones are increasingly favored by people as a music transmission device, especially young people, and are an indispensable daily necessity in life. The existing headset has high requirements on the tone quality of the headset and the wearing comfort and the aesthetic property. Therefore, the ear-packs of the headphones are required to be rotatable for optimal comfort of the user wearing the headphones.
At present, common mechanisms for headphones are: the earphone comprises a head band, an earphone support and an earphone bag, wherein the two ends of the head band are respectively provided with the earphone support, and the earphone bag is arranged on the earphone support. The rotation of the ear cup is generally achieved in two positions, namely, the position between the earphone bracket and the headband and the position between the earphone bracket and the ear cup.
Specifically, be provided with rotatable connection structure between earphone support top and the bandeau, earphone support can realize the rotation of left and right directions for the bandeau, is provided with rotatable connection structure between earphone support both sides and the ear package, and the ear package can realize the rotation of upper and lower direction for the earphone support.
Above-mentioned structure needs to realize rotating at earphone support both ends, and the structure is complicated, and complex operation, user experience is not good.

Detailed Description
The design concept of the invention is as follows:
aiming at the defects of the rotating structure of the middle ear drum in the prior art, the invention provides the headphone, the rear ear drum shell is connected with the head band through the rotating shaft, the ball head is arranged at one end of the rotating shaft connected with the head band, the limiting shaft is arranged on the ball head, and the rear ear drum shell can rotate left and right and up and down relative to the head band under the limiting action of the limiting shaft by utilizing the characteristics of the ball head, so that the rear ear drum shell can rotate left and right and up and down at one position.

Example 1
In this embodiment, a headphone according to an embodiment 1 of the present invention is shown in fig. 1, 2 and 4, and includes a headband 3, a sliding bracket is disposed at an end of the headband 3, an ear-pack rear case 7 is mounted on the sliding bracket, the ear-pack rear case 7 is a part of an ear pack, and is a base of the ear pack, a rotating shaft 5 is mounted on the ear-pack rear case 7, and the ear-pack rear case 7 is connected with the sliding bracket through the rotating shaft 5.
One end of the rotating shaft 5 connected with the sliding support is provided with a ball head 51, a limiting shaft 52 is arranged on the ball head 51 and perpendicular to the axis of the rotating shaft 5, the ear-bag rear shell 7 rotates vertically relative to the sliding support around the axis direction of the limiting shaft 52 (the direction indicated by an arc arrow M in fig. 1), and the ear-bag rear shell 7 rotates left and right relative to the sliding support around the axis direction of the perpendicular limiting shaft 52 (the direction indicated by an arc arrow N in fig. 2).
As shown in fig. 5, the axis of the rotation shaft 5 is a Z axis, the axis about which the ear cup rear case 7 rotates in the up-down direction is a Y axis, and the axis about which the ear cup rear case 7 rotates in the left-right direction is an X axis.
The axis of the left-right rotation of the ear-pack rear shell 7 passes through the center of the ball head and is vertical to the axis of the limiting shaft 52.
The limiting shaft 52 mainly prevents the rotating shaft 5 from rotating 360 degrees, because the ear-pack can rotate around the axis of the rotating shaft 5 without limitation, the ear-pack is inconvenient to wear and use, and the power line and the signal line in the ear-pack are twisted.
The headband 3 is provided with a sliding rail, the sliding rail can be formed by a long hole on the headband 3, and the sliding bracket can slide on the headband 3 along the sliding rail to adjust the position on the headband 3. Through this structural arrangement, the position of the ear packs on the headband 3 can be adjusted, thereby adjusting the distance between the ear packs, adapting to different users.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the sliding support is provided with a rotating shaft base 8, the rotating shaft 5 is connected with the rotating shaft base 8, the ball head 51 is positioned in the rotating shaft base 8, and the limiting shaft 52 comprises two sections of shafts symmetrically arranged on two sides of the ball head 51. The rotating shaft base 8 is arranged in cooperation with the ball head 51 and the limiting shaft 52 of the rotating shaft 5 and guides the rotating shaft 5 to rotate.
As shown in fig. 7, a first through hole 84 is provided at the bottom of the spindle base 8, the spindle 5 passes through the first through hole 84, and the first through hole 84 is tapered to limit the rotation angle of the spindle 5. Through this structure setting, can avoid the ear-bag to make unnecessary, too big turned angle, avoid the shape of headphone to become uncoordinated, inconvenient wearing.
The rotary shaft base 8 is provided with a limit groove, the shape of the limit groove is matched with the ball head of the rotary shaft 5 and the limit shaft 52, the limit groove comprises a spherical limit groove 81 and a linear limit groove 82, and the ball head 51 can rotate around the axis direction of the limit shaft 52 and around the axis direction of the vertical limit shaft 52 in the limit groove 81. The limit groove constitutes a rotation guide member of the ball head 51, thereby guiding the rotation of the rotation shaft 5.
The ball head 51 is provided with a spherical limit groove 81, the limit shaft 52 is provided with a linear limit groove 82, the bottom of the linear limit groove 82 is provided with a limit inclined surface 83, and the end of the limit shaft 52 is just inclined when rotating to the position.
In this embodiment, the sliding support includes an outer clamping plate 1, an inner clamping plate 9 and a decorative cover 2, the outer clamping plate 1 and the inner clamping plate 9 are respectively located at the outer side and the inner side of the headband 3, the outer clamping plate 1 and the inner clamping plate 9 are combined through screws, the decorative cover 2 and the inner clamping plate 9 are combined through clamping, a rotating shaft base 8 is located in the decorative cover 2, and the rotating shaft base 8 and the inner clamping plate 9 are connected and fixed through second screws 10.
As shown in fig. 6, three mounting holes are formed in three corners of the shaft base 8, and three second screws 10 can be mounted, and one corner is missing, where the third threading hole is formed in the rear shell 7 of the ear drum.
The second screw 10 can also function as a combination of the outer clamping plate 1 and the inner clamping plate 9 at the same time, thus omitting one set of screws.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the inner clamping plate 9 is provided with a ball head 51 for pressing the rotating shaft 5 by a positioning block, the ball head 51 is held in the rotating shaft base 8, and a surface of the positioning block 54, which is in contact with the ball head 51, is in a concave spherical shape.
The outer clamping plate 1 and the inner clamping plate 9 are arranged, and the outer clamping plate 1 and the inner clamping plate 9 clamp the headband 3 so as to facilitate the installation of the sliding bracket on the headband 3.
Guide blocks may be provided on the outer clamp plate 1 and/or the inner clamp plate 9 to slidably guide in the guide rails of the headband 3. The decorative cover 2 can cover the rotating shaft base 8, so that the appearance of the part is improved, and the appearance is tidy.
The upper side and the lower side of the decorative cover 2 are inclined planes, so that the upper and lower rotation process of the ear-bag rear shell 7 is avoided. Through this structure setting, both can realize decorating lid 2 self covering effect, can reserve the rotation space for the ear drum again.
The upper side of the decorative cover 2 is provided with a first threading hole 23 for introducing a power line and/or a signal line, and the side of the decorative cover 2 adjacent to the ear-pack rear case 7 is provided with a second threading hole 22 for introducing a power line and/or a signal line, which is a structure provided for connecting lines between ear packs, as shown in fig. 7.
As shown in fig. 8, a second through hole 21 is provided on the side of the decorative cover 2 adjacent to the ear-pack rear case 7, the rotation shaft 5 passes through the second through hole 21, and a shock absorbing sponge 4 is provided around the second through hole 21 between the decorative cover 2 and the ear-pack rear case 7. The damping sponge 4 can be fixed on the decorative cover 2 or on the ear-pack rear shell 7, and the damping sponge 4 can absorb the rotation shock of the ear-pack, and can also avoid hard friction between the ear-pack rear shell 7 and the decorative cover 2.
As shown in fig. 1, 2 and 7, an axial threaded hole 53 is formed at one end of the rotating shaft 5 connected with the ear-pack rear shell 7, the rotating shaft 5 is fixedly connected with the ear-pack rear shell 7 through a third screw 6, and the third screw 6 is provided with an anti-slip structure.
Because the diameter of the ball end of the rotating shaft 5 is larger, the other end of the rotating shaft 5 needs to pass through the first through hole 84 of the rotating shaft base 8, so the rotating shaft 5 and the ear-pack rear shell 7 are in a detachable connection structure.
The third screw 6 may be a non-slip screw with its own non-slip structure, for example, a ring of protrusions on the bottom surface of the nut, so as to prevent the third screw 6 from being loosened from the shaft 5. The stability of the connection structure of the rotating shaft 5 and the ear-bag rear shell 7 can be improved by performing anti-skid treatment on the third screw 6.
As shown in fig. 5 and 7, the end of the rotating shaft 5 provided with the threaded hole 53 is provided with an anti-rotation protrusion 55 and a positioning block 54, and the anti-rotation protrusion 55 and the positioning block 54 are also symmetrically arranged on the rotating shaft 5.
The back shell 7 of the ear bag is provided with a positioning groove 71, an anti-rotation groove 72 is arranged in the positioning groove 71, one end of the rotating shaft 5 provided with the threaded hole 53 is arranged in the positioning groove 71, and a third through hole 73 is arranged at the bottom of the positioning groove 71 for the third screw 6 to pass through, as shown in fig. 3.
The positioning block 54 and the positioning groove 71 can be conveniently connected and combined with the rotating shaft 5 and the ear-bag rear shell 7.
The rotation preventing protrusions 55 are arranged on the rotating shaft 5, the rotation preventing grooves 72 are arranged in the positioning grooves 71 of the ear-pack rear shell 7, and rotation between the rotating shaft 5 and the ear-pack rear shell 7 in the rotation process of the ear-pack can be prevented through the rotation preventing structure, so that the stability of the connecting structure of the rotating shaft 5 and the ear-pack rear shell 7 is improved.
The ear-pack rear case 7 is provided with a third threading hole for introducing a power supply line and/or a signal line (the third threading hole is not shown).
The assembly process of the sliding support, the ear shell rear shell 7 and the headband 3 of the invention comprises the following steps:
1) Mounting the outer and inner clips 1, 9 to the headband 3;
2) Mounting the spindle 5 into the spindle base 8;
3) The rotating shaft base 8 is fixed on the sliding base plate 9 through three second screws 10;
4) Mounting the decorative cover 2 to the inner clamping plate 9;
5) The damping sponge 4 is mounted on the decorative cover 2 or the ear-bag rear shell 7 and is adhered and fixed;
6) The ear-pack rear shell 7 is fixedly connected with the rotating shaft 5 through a third screw 6, and the third screw 6 is subjected to necessary anti-skid wire treatment.
In order to ensure sufficient strength of the rotating shaft 5, MIM (metal injection molded) members or stainless steel workpieces can be selected; in order to ensure smooth sliding of the spindle base 8, the spindle base 8 is made of a POM (thermoplastic crystalline polymer) member or a PA (polyamide) member.
According to the invention, one end of the rotating shaft 5, which is connected with the rotating shaft base 8, is designed into a ball head structure, the ball head structure can realize 360-degree rotation, but a limiting shaft 52 is additionally arranged on the ball head structure, and a limiting groove is arranged in the rotating shaft base 8, so that the ear drum can be prevented from rotating for 360 degrees, the ear drum is allowed to rotate up and down and left and right, and meanwhile, the rotating angle is limited by utilizing a through hole on the rotating shaft base 8. The structure saves installation space, the ear drum steering operation is simple, and the wearing experience of a user is improved.
